🥘 Ingredients

15 items
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 yellow onion, diced
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 can (15 ounces) black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up corn kernels, fresh or frozen
  • 1 can (10 ounces) diced tomatoes with green chilies (Rotel-style)
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on black pepper
  • 6 flour tortillas (8-inch)
  • 2 cups shredded Mexican-blend cheese
  • 0.25 cup fresh cilantro, chopped (optional, for garnish)

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a 9x13-inch baking dish.

2

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ced onion and red bell pepper and sauté for 5 minutes, or until softened.

3

Stir in the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ute, until fragrant.

4

Add the black beans, corn, diced tomatoes with green chilies, c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, salt, and black pepper. Stir well to combine and simmer the mixture for 5 minutes. Remove from heat.

5

Place two flour tortillas in the bottom of the prepared baking dish, overlapping slightly to cover the entire base.

6

Spread one-third of the bean and vegetable mixture over the tortillas, then sprinkle one-third of the shredded cheese on top.

7

Repeat the layering process two more times, using all the tortillas, filling, and cheese. The top layer should be cheese.

8

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 15 minutes.

9

Rem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den brown.

10

Let the casserole cool for 5 minutes, then garnish with fresh cilantro if desired. Slice and serve warm.
